Wired for Gaming: Brain Differences Found in Compulsive Video Game Players

Description

SALT LAKE CITY - Brain scans from nearly 200 adolescent boys provide evidence that the brains of compulsive video game players are wired differently. Chronic video game play is associated with hyperconnectivity between several pairs of brain networks. Some of the changes are predicted to help game players respond to new information. Other changes are associated with distractibility and poor impulse control. The research, a collaboration between the University of Utah School of Medicine, and Chung-Ang University in South Korea, was published online in Addiction Biology on Dec. 22, 2015.
